您的位置:首页 > 移动开发 > Android开发

android assets 下文件中文乱码解决

2016-03-09 14:38 405 查看
1、问题原因:文件存编码格式和读取格式不一样

2、解决:统一为utf8格式

步骤:

1、将读取出现乱码的文件另存为UTF-8格式

        2、在客户端读取时,使用UTF-8格式读取:

InputStream is = null;
StringBuilder sb = new StringBuilder();

is= this.getResources().getAssets().open(filename); //打开文件

InputStreamReader isr = new InputStreamReader(is,"UTF-8");   //指定格式


                                            
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  android 中文 乱码